What will the weather in Bandai Atami Onsen be like during my visit?
The warmest months in Bandai Atami Onsen are usually August and July with an average temp of 70°F. January and February are the chilliest months when the average temp is 33°F. The rainiest months are July and September.

Awaken Your Senses: Unveiling the Serenity of Bandai Atami Onsen

Nestled in the picturesque Koriyama region of Fukushima Prefecture, Bandai Atami Onsen is a hidden gem renowned for its serene hot springs and breathtaking natural beauty. Surrounded by the majestic Bandai mountains and the tranquil shores of Lake Inawashiro, this destination offers a perfect blend of relaxation and adventure. Visitors can unwind in luxurious onsens, explore the nearby art museum, or hike scenic trails for stunning views. With its charming atmosphere and rich cultural heritage, Bandai Atami Onsen is an idyllic retreat for those seeking a peaceful escape or a romantic getaway amidst Japan's enchanting landscapes.

Best time to go to Bandai Atami Onsen

Bandai Atami Onsen exper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 29.3°F (-1.5°C), while August is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 74.5°F (23.6°C). July t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Bandai Atami Onsen are August, October, and November,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, accompanied by light rainfall. In contrast, January, February, and December are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
